diff --git a/app/src/main/res/drawable/ic_widget_error.xml b/app/src/leanback/res/drawable/ic_widget_error.xml
similarity index 100%
rename from app/src/main/res/drawable/ic_widget_error.xml
rename to app/src/leanback/res/drawable/ic_widget_error.xml
diff --git a/app/src/leanback/res/drawable/shape_widget.xml b/app/src/leanback/res/drawable/shape_widget.xml
index 78cfa62ed..2514944ee 100644
--- a/app/src/leanback/res/drawable/shape_widget.xml
+++ b/app/src/leanback/res/drawable/shape_widget.xml
@@ -6,4 +6,10 @@
+
+
\ No newline at end of file
diff --git a/app/src/leanback/res/layout/view_widget_cast.xml b/app/src/leanback/res/layout/view_widget_cast.xml
index cb51167e4..2057d7a43 100644
--- a/app/src/leanback/res/layout/view_widget_cast.xml
+++ b/app/src/leanback/res/layout/view_widget_cast.xml
@@ -77,7 +77,6 @@
android:background="@drawable/shape_widget"
android:gravity="center"
android:orientation="vertical"
- android:padding="16dp"
android:visibility="gone"
tools:visibility="visible">
@@ -90,7 +89,6 @@
android:id="@+id/text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
- android:layout_marginTop="16dp"
android:gravity="center"
android:textColor="@color/white"
android:textSize="16sp"
@@ -106,7 +104,6 @@
android:background="@drawable/shape_widget"
android:gravity="center"
android:orientation="vertical"
- android:padding="16dp"
android:visibility="gone"
tools:visibility="visible">
diff --git a/app/src/leanback/res/layout/view_widget_live.xml b/app/src/leanback/res/layout/view_widget_live.xml
index 8b6333652..35eedee64 100644
--- a/app/src/leanback/res/layout/view_widget_live.xml
+++ b/app/src/leanback/res/layout/view_widget_live.xml
@@ -78,7 +78,6 @@
android:background="@drawable/shape_widget"
android:gravity="center"
android:orientation="vertical"
- android:padding="16dp"
android:visibility="gone"
tools:visibility="visible">
@@ -91,7 +90,6 @@
android:id="@+id/text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
- android:layout_marginTop="16dp"
android:gravity="center"
android:textColor="@color/white"
android:textSize="16sp"
@@ -107,7 +105,6 @@
android:background="@drawable/shape_widget"
android:includeFontPadding="false"
android:letterSpacing="0.05"
- android:padding="16dp"
android:textColor="@color/white"
android:textSize="64sp"
android:visibility="gone"
@@ -122,7 +119,6 @@
android:background="@drawable/shape_widget"
android:gravity="center"
android:orientation="vertical"
- android:padding="16dp"
android:visibility="gone"
tools:visibility="visible">
diff --git a/app/src/leanback/res/layout/view_widget_vod.xml b/app/src/leanback/res/layout/view_widget_vod.xml
index 5577d311c..cf8760aab 100644
--- a/app/src/leanback/res/layout/view_widget_vod.xml
+++ b/app/src/leanback/res/layout/view_widget_vod.xml
@@ -76,7 +76,6 @@
android:background="@drawable/shape_widget"
android:gravity="center"
android:orientation="vertical"
- android:padding="16dp"
android:visibility="gone"
tools:visibility="visible">
@@ -89,7 +88,6 @@
android:id="@+id/text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
- android:layout_marginTop="16dp"
android:gravity="center"
android:textColor="@color/white"
android:textSize="16sp"
@@ -105,7 +103,6 @@
android:background="@drawable/shape_widget"
android:gravity="center"
android:orientation="vertical"
- android:padding="16dp"
android:visibility="gone"
tools:visibility="visible">
diff --git a/app/src/mobile/java/com/fongmi/android/tv/ui/activity/LiveActivity.java b/app/src/mobile/java/com/fongmi/android/tv/ui/activity/LiveActivity.java
index b1044547b..7b0a03375 100644
--- a/app/src/mobile/java/com/fongmi/android/tv/ui/activity/LiveActivity.java
+++ b/app/src/mobile/java/com/fongmi/android/tv/ui/activity/LiveActivity.java
@@ -490,13 +490,13 @@ public class LiveActivity extends BaseActivity implements CustomKeyDown.Listener
private void showError(String text) {
mBinding.widget.error.setVisibility(View.VISIBLE);
- mBinding.widget.text.setText(text);
+ mBinding.widget.error.setText(text);
hideProgress();
}
private void hideError() {
mBinding.widget.error.setVisibility(View.GONE);
- mBinding.widget.text.setText("");
+ mBinding.widget.error.setText("");
}
private void showControl() {
diff --git a/app/src/mobile/java/com/fongmi/android/tv/ui/activity/VideoActivity.java b/app/src/mobile/java/com/fongmi/android/tv/ui/activity/VideoActivity.java
index 07ad3c83e..be589b1ed 100644
--- a/app/src/mobile/java/com/fongmi/android/tv/ui/activity/VideoActivity.java
+++ b/app/src/mobile/java/com/fongmi/android/tv/ui/activity/VideoActivity.java
@@ -941,13 +941,13 @@ public class VideoActivity extends BaseActivity implements Clock.Callback, Custo
private void showError(String text) {
mBinding.widget.error.setVisibility(View.VISIBLE);
- mBinding.widget.text.setText(text);
+ mBinding.widget.error.setText(text);
hideProgress();
}
private void hideError() {
mBinding.widget.error.setVisibility(View.GONE);
- mBinding.widget.text.setText("");
+ mBinding.widget.error.setText("");
}
private void showDanmaku() {
diff --git a/app/src/mobile/res/drawable/ic_widget_error.xml b/app/src/mobile/res/drawable/ic_widget_error.xml
new file mode 100644
index 000000000..006b531b6
--- /dev/null
+++ b/app/src/mobile/res/drawable/ic_widget_error.xml
@@ -0,0 +1,16 @@
+
+
+
+
+
diff --git a/app/src/mobile/res/layout/view_widget_live.xml b/app/src/mobile/res/layout/view_widget_live.xml
index db1c46737..99437c8dc 100644
--- a/app/src/mobile/res/layout/view_widget_live.xml
+++ b/app/src/mobile/res/layout/view_widget_live.xml
@@ -5,33 +5,20 @@
android:layout_width="match_parent"
android:layout_height="match_parent">
-
-
-
-
-
-
-
+ tools:text="@string/error_play_url"
+ tools:visibility="visible" />
-
-
-
-
-
-
-
+ tools:text="@string/error_play_url"
+ tools:visibility="visible" />